Sitting? Standing? Squatting? What's the best position for people with penises to pee? While it really depends on your preference, one study found sitting has medical benefits for certain people. 👇
or different urinary problems in men that include intermittent urine streams, the sudden urge to pee, straining to pee, and more.In this report we’ve looked at the influences of changing urination posture on the maximum urine flow, the time spent voiding and the amount of urine that is left in the bladder. We conclude that the sitting posture is the best position for men with urination problems, e.g. due to an enlarged prostate to urinate in, whereas no difference was found in healthy men.
They also pointed out that their study, “does not translate into a medically preferable position for healthy males to urinate in.” “Men may start peeing sitting if their prostates are large and they need to help relax the pelvic muscles in an effort to help push the urine out,” Jamin Brahmbhatt, a urologist and professor at the University of Central Florida College of Medicine, told
